(最終更新日: 2026年06月07日)
プログラミング学習を加速させたいけれど、話題の自律型AI「Claude Code」は月額料金が気になって、なかなか手が出せないと悩んでいませんか?
「学生にはコストが高すぎる」「初心者でも本当に使いこなせるのか」といった不安を感じるのは、非常に自然なことです。
しかし、このツールを正しく導入すれば、あなたの開発効率は劇的に向上し、まるで専属のメンターが隣にいるような心強い学習環境が手に入ります。
この記事では、Claude Codeの基礎知識から、学生でも無理なく続けられる料金の最適化術、さらには初心者でも迷わない導入ステップまでを丁寧に解説します。
最新のAI技術を賢く味方につけて、周囲と圧倒的な差をつけるエンジニアリングスキルを今すぐ手に入れましょう!
開発のパラダイムシフト:自律型AIエージェント「Claude Code」の基礎知識
当セクションでは、開発環境を劇的に変える「Claude Code」の基本的な仕組みと、従来のAIツールとは一線を画す革新性について深掘りします。
AIが単なる補助役から自律的なパートナーへと進化を遂げた背景を知ることは、これからのエンジニアリングに不可欠なスキルを養うための重要な第一歩となるからです。
- コード補完から「自律実行」へ:従来ツールとの決定的な違い
- Sonnet 4.5を基盤とする高度な推論能力とコンテキスト管理
- Model Context Protocol (MCP)による外部ツールとのシームレスな統合
コード補完から「自律実行」へ:従来ツールとの決定的な違い
Claude Codeは、従来のコード補完の枠を超え、開発タスクを自ら完結させる「自律型エージェント」としての性質を持っています。
従来のツールが数行のコードを予測するにとどまっていたのに対し、本ツールはリポジトリ全体を俯瞰し、テストの実行やエラーの修正までを自律的に繰り返すからです。
例えば、認証機能の追加という曖昧な指示に対しても、必要なファイルを検索してコードを書き換え、バグがあればログを分析して自己修復を行います。
Claude Code vs GitHub Copilot 完全比較の記事でも詳しく解説されています。
能動的にプロジェクトを前進させるこの仕組みこそが、現代の開発における決定的な違いと言えます。
Sonnet 4.5を基盤とする高度な推論能力とコンテキスト管理
開発者が手動で行っていた情報の受け渡しを不要にする、最新のSonnet 4.5による圧倒的な推論能力と広大なコンテキスト管理が本ツールの核となっています。
20万トークンという膨大な情報を一度に処理できるため、プロジェクト内の複雑な依存関係やアーキテクチャをAIが自ら瞬時に把握することが可能だからです。
大規模なモノレポ環境であっても、ディレクトリ構造を深くまで読み取り、モジュール間の整合性を保ちながら最適な修正案を提示してくれます。
詳細な管理手法についてはClaude Codeのコンテキスト管理完全ガイドが参考になりますが、CLI経由でプロジェクト全体を瞬時に理解する体験はこれまでのツールでは得られません。
広範な知識ベースを自動で同期するこの仕組みは、開発者がより本質的な設計業務に集中できる理想的な環境をもたらします。
Model Context Protocol (MCP)による外部ツールとのシームレスな統合
Model Context Protocol(MCP)の採用により、Claude Codeはローカル環境や外部サービスとシームレスに連携できる高度な拡張性を備えています。
独自のデータベースやAPI、さらにはドキュメント検索ツールと直接接続することで、AIがプロジェクト固有のルールや現実に即した解決策を提示できるようになるためです。
実際にMCPサーバーを介して外部情報を取得させれば、ネット上の一般論に留まらない、より実用的なコード生成が可能になります。
自分の開発スタイルに合わせてツールを自由に繋ぎ合わせることで、AIをただのチャットボットではなく、真の業務実行エンジンへと進化させられるでしょう。
ツール同士を繋ぐこのオープンな規格を使いこなすための基礎は、生成AI 最速仕事術などの資料を通じて学ぶのも一つの手です。
AIエージェントを日々の開発プロセスに不可欠な存在へと昇華させるこの統合能力は、今後のスタンダードになっていくはずです。
学生が直面するコスト問題:料金プランの詳細と無償クレジット獲得法
当セクションでは、学生がClaude Codeを導入する際に直面する最大の壁である「コスト」の解決策について、具体的なプランの比較と無償で利用するための公式制度を詳しく解説します。
自律型AIは非常に強力ですが、APIコストや月額料金の構造を正しく理解していないと、継続的な学習の大きな負担になりかねないためです。
- Claude Proプラン(月額20ドル)の費用対効果を再検証する
- Student Builder Programへの申請手順と審査合格のポイント
- 大学機関向け「Claude for Education」の導入状況を確認する方法
Claude Proプラン(月額20ドル)の費用対効果を再検証する
学生にとって月額20ドルの支出は決して小さくありませんが、週に10時間以上の開発を行うならその費用対効果は圧倒的です。
無料枠の制限に縛られながらエラー解決に5時間を浪費するのと、Proプランで解決策を15分で導き出すのとでは、学習の密度が根本から異なります。
実際に時給換算すれば数百円の投資で、24時間いつでも相談できる「熟練エンジニアの思考」を借りられる計算になります。
Claude Codeセットアップガイドでも解説している通り、Proプランは新機能への早期アクセスも保証されており、最新のAI技術に触れ続けたい学生には最適な選択肢です。
AIを単なる「出費」ではなく、将来の自分を強化するための「自己投資」として捉え直すことで、開発効率は劇的に向上するでしょう。
AIを使いこなすための思考整理やプロンプトの型については、書籍「生成AI 最速仕事術」なども併せて活用することをお勧めします。
Student Builder Programへの申請手順と審査合格のポイント
自分のプロジェクトを本格的に進めたい学生は、Anthropicが提供するStudent Builder Programへの申請を検討してください。
このプログラムは、大学ドメインのメールアドレスを持つ学生イノベーターに対し、開発用のAPIクレジットを無償で提供する唯一の公式ルートです。
申請の際は、単に課題で使うという理由だけでなく、GitHubなどでの「オープンソース活動への貢献意欲」を英語で具体的に記述することが承認率を高める鍵となります。
英文テンプレートとして、以下のような構成で記述すると、開発への情熱とツールの必要性が明確に伝わります。
- “I am developing an open-source tool using Claude Code to automate code reviews.”
- “My project aims to help students understand complex software architectures more efficiently.”
審査には通常5〜7営業日ほど要しますが、一度承認されれば個人で多額のトークン料金を負担することなく自律型開発に没頭できます(参考: CometAPI)。
ツールを使いこなすだけでなく、その背景にあるアルゴリズムや開発スキルそのものを高めたい学生には、
のようなコーチングサービスも成長を加速させる助けになるはずです。
大学機関向け「Claude for Education」の導入状況を確認する方法
個人の財布を痛める前に、まずは所属する大学がClaude for Educationを導入していないか必ず確認しましょう。
Anthropic社はInternet2やCanvasなどの教育インフラを通じて大学単位での契約を進めており、導入済みの大学では学生がエンタープライズ級の機能を無償利用できるためです。
学内ポータルの「ITサービス一覧」を確認するか、大学のITセンターへ直接「Claude Enterpriseプランの提供状況」について問い合わせてみてください。
もし大学側がまだ未導入であれば、学術的誠実性を守る「ラーニングモード」などの教育向け機能を持ち出すことで、研究室単位での導入を働きかける余地もあります。
キャンパス全体のライセンスが利用できれば、制限を気にせず最新のAIエージェントを学習の伴走者として活用できるはずです(参考: Anthropic)。
講義や研究内容を効率的に整理し、開発の設計フェーズに活かすなら、最新AIを搭載した録音ツールPLAUD NOTEの活用も非常に効果的です。
初心者でも迷わない:Claude Codeの導入手順と環境構築の最適解
当セクションでは、Claude Codeを自分のPCで動かすための具体的な導入手順と、効率を最大化する環境設定について詳しく解説します。
自律型AIをエンジニアリングの強力な味方にするためには、まずツールが正常に機能する安定した土台を築くことが不可欠だからです。
- Node.js環境の整備とClaude Code CLIのインストール手順
- VS Code拡張機能とターミナルの併用によるハイブリッド開発術
- 最初のタスク実行:自律的なバグ修正とテスト生成のデモンストレーション
Node.js環境の整備とClaude Code CLIのインストール手順
Node.jsのLTS(長期サポート)バージョンをインストールすることが、環境構築における最初の重要なステップとなります。
Claude CodeはNode.jsランタイム上で動作するため、最新の安定版を使用することで互換性トラブルを未然に防ぐことが可能です。
ターミナルを開き、以下のコマンドを実行してツールをプロジェクト外からも呼び出せるようグローバルにインストールしましょう。
npm install -g @anthropic-ai/claude-code
もしWindowsやMacで権限エラー(EACCES)が発生した場合は、nvmなどのバージョン管理ツールを使用してユーザーディレクトリ内に環境を構築するか、適切な権限設定を確認してください。
詳細は(参考: Claude Codeセットアップガイド)でも解説されていますが、インストール完了後に認証を済ませればすぐに利用を開始できます。
正しい環境設定を済ませることで、AIエージェントのパフォーマンスを最大限に引き出す準備が整います。
VS Code拡張機能とターミナルの併用によるハイブリッド開発術
ターミナルでの高速なコマンド操作と、VS Code拡張機能による視覚的なコード管理を組み合わせるハイブリッドスタイルが、現在の開発現場における最適解です。
CLIはプロジェクト全体の解析や複雑なタスクの一括実行に優れている一方、エディタ側の機能は変更箇所をリアルタイムで直感的に把握するのに非常に役立ちます。
特に、Claudeが生成したコードや図を即座に確認できるArtifacts機能は、エディタと併用することでその真価を存分に発揮するでしょう。
作業効率を高めるために、画面の左半分にエディタを、右半分にターミナルを配置するワークスペース配置を強く推奨いたします。
この体制を整えることで、AIが加えた変更をその場でレビューしながら、次の指示を淀みなく出すことが可能になります。
ツールごとの特性を理解して使い分けることが、自律型AIを使いこなす熟練エンジニアへの近道といえるでしょう。
最初のタスク実行:自律的なバグ修正とテスト生成のデモンストレーション
環境構築が終わった後の最初のアクションとして、既存のリポジトリに対して具体的な改善タスクを一つ指示して、AIエージェントの挙動を観察してみましょう。
例えば「ログイン機能のユニットテストを追加して」といった明確なゴールを与えることで、Claude Codeがどのようにファイルをスキャンし、変更案を組み立てるのかを体験できます。
指示を入力すると、AIは自律的に関連ファイルを読み込み、テストコードを作成した後に、あなたの承認を求めるためのプレビューを提示します。
claude "add a unit test for the login function"
人間が最終的な変更内容をレビューし、承認を下すことで初めて実際のファイルに反映されるため、安全性を保ちながら開発を加速させることが可能です。
この一連のプロセスを繰り返すことで、AIを単なるツールではなく、信頼できる開発パートナーとして活用する感覚が身に付きます。
より高度なAIエンジニアリングスキルを体系的に学びたい方は、
のようなサービスで、基礎から応用までを習得するのも非常におすすめです。
思考停止を防ぐ:ラーニングモードを用いたソクラテス式学習法
当セクションでは、Claude Codeを単なる便利ツールに留めず、自らの「思考力」を磨くためのラーニングモード活用術を解説します。
なぜなら、自律型AIに依存しすぎることは学生にとって思考停止のリスクを孕んでおり、正しい学習プロセスを構築することが将来のエンジニアリング能力に直結するからです。
- 答えを教えない「ラーニングモード」の設定と教育的メリット
- CodePath流:AIメンターを活用したオープンソースへの貢献手法
- 学問的誠実性(Academic Integrity)を守るためのAI利用ガイドライン
答えを教えない「ラーニングモード」の設定と教育的メリット
ラーニングモードは、AIを単なる解答作成ツールではなく学習を深化させる教育的コーチへと進化させます。
これはAnthropic社が提唱する「AIとの共同創造」の概念を具現化したもので、ユーザーの推論プロセスを強化する設計がなされています。
具体的には、Projects機能内で「いきなりコードを書かず、まずは私の設計案にフィードバックをください」と指示を出すことで、対話を通じた深い理解が可能です。
ソクラテス式の問答法を取り入れたこの手法は、学生が自律的に問題を解決する力を養うために極めて有効なアプローチとなります。(参考: Anthropic)
CodePath流:AIメンターを活用したオープンソースへの貢献手法
大規模なオープンソースプロジェクト(OSS)への貢献は、Claude Codeを熟練のメンターとして併走させることで驚くほどスムーズになります。
膨大で未知のコードベースであっても、AIがディレクトリ構造やモジュール間の依存関係を瞬時に解析し、初学者にも分かりやすくマッピングしてくれるためです。
実際にCodePathの学生は、未経験の言語で書かれたGitLabなどのリポジトリに対し、Claude Codeの解説を頼りにバグ修正や機能追加のプルリクエストを成功させています。
このワークフローを習得すれば、学生のうちから世界レベルの開発コミュニティに参加し、実践的なキャリアを構築できるでしょう。
さらに自身のプログラミングスキルを根幹から高めたい場合は、Aidemyのようなオンラインコーチングで理論を補強するのも非常に効果的です。
学問的誠実性(Academic Integrity)を守るためのAI利用ガイドライン
AIを学習に取り入れる上で最も重視すべきなのは、学問的誠実性(Academic Integrity)を自律的に維持し続ける姿勢です。
AIが生成したコードをそのまま提出する行為は、自らの成長機会を奪うだけでなく、教育機関の倫理基準に抵触する重大なリスクを招きます。
トラブルを回避するためにも、AI利用の経緯を明示し、生成されたロジックに対して自分なりの解釈をコメントとして追記する習慣を徹底しましょう。
プロジェクトにおける適切なルール設定については、Claude Codeルール設定完全ガイドを参考に、自分なりの運用方針を定めることが推奨されます。
誠実な対話を繰り返すプロセスこそが、AIを「カンニングの道具」から「知性を拡張する最高のパートナー」へと昇華させる唯一の道です。
財布に優しい高度な運用:プロンプトキャッシングとコスト最適化術
当セクションでは、Claude Codeを経済的に運用するための「プロンプトキャッシング」の仕組みや、予期せぬ支出を防ぐ「支出上限設定」、そしてトークン消費を抑える実践的なテクニックについて詳しく解説します。
学生が個人でAPIを利用する際、最も大きな懸念点はコスト管理であり、技術的な最適化手法を学ぶことで、限られた予算内でも高度なAIエージェントの恩恵を最大限に享受できるようになるからです。
- 「プロンプトキャッシング」でAPIコストを10分の1に抑える仕組み
- 支出上限設定(Spend Limits)による「ビルショック」の完全回避法
- トークン消費を最小化するコマンドの書き方とMCPツールの制御
「プロンプトキャッシング」でAPIコストを10分の1に抑える仕組み
プロンプトキャッシングは、一度読み込んだコード情報を一時的に保存して再利用することでAPIの入力コストを最大90%削減できる画期的な機能です。
Claude Codeがアクションを起こすたびに発生する莫大なトークン消費を、キャッシュされたデータからの高速な読み込みに置き換えることで、通常の10分の1という驚異的な低料金での処理が実現します。
長時間のコーディングセッションや巨大なプロジェクトのデバッグ作業において、この仕組みは累積コストに劇的な差を生む重要な要素となります。(参考: Claude Codeのトークン制限を完全攻略!消費の仕組みと劇的な節約テクニック徹底解説)
| 項目(Sonnet 4.6想定) | 通常の入力(100万トークン) | キャッシュ読み込み(ヒット時) |
|---|---|---|
| 料金単価 | $3.00 | $0.30 |
| コスト削減率 | 基準 | 90% OFF |
キャッシュの有効活用を意識してセッションを維持することで、限られたバイト代や仕送りの範囲内でも、プロレベルのAI開発環境を安定して運用し続けることが可能になります。
支出上限設定(Spend Limits)による「ビルショック」の完全回避法
Anthropic Consoleの管理画面で「支出上限設定」を事前に行うことは、予期せぬ高額請求(ビルショック)を物理的に防ぐための最も確実な防衛策です。
複雑なコードの自動生成中に意図しないループが発生したり、大規模なリファクタリングを繰り返したりした場合でも、あらかじめ決めた月額予算に達した瞬間にAPIが自動停止するため、支払い能力を超える請求が届く心配はありません。
「Settings > Workspaces」メニュー内にある「Limits」タブへ進み、自分の経済状況に合わせて「Monthly Spend Limit」を50ドルや100ドルといった無理のない数値に固定しておくことを強く推奨します。
安全装置を正しく稼働させておくことで、コストの増大を過度に恐れることなく、AIエージェントとの自由な試行錯誤や大規模なプログラミング学習に没頭できる環境が手に入ります。
トークン消費を最小化するコマンドの書き方とMCPツールの制御
コストパフォーマンスを究極まで高めるためには、プロンプトによる検索範囲の限定と不要な機能の無効化を徹底することが欠かせません。
Claude Codeはデフォルトで広範囲を解析しようと動きますが、解析対象を特定のサブディレクトリに絞り込む具体的な指示を与えることで、無駄な入力トークンの発生を最小限に食い止められます。
作業中に/mcpコマンドを利用して不要な外部検索ツールをOFFに設定する習慣をつければ、APIコールごとに加算されるシステムプロンプトのオーバーヘッドも確実に削減できるでしょう。
AIの挙動を賢くコントロールするスキルを磨くことは、将来エンジニアとして活躍する際のリソース管理能力にも直結し、結果として毎月の運用コストを大幅に引き下げる鍵となります。
より高度な「プロンプトの型」を学びたい場合は、生成AI 最速仕事術などの書籍を参考に、AIへの命令精度を高める思考法を身につけるのが近道です。
まとめ:Claude Codeを味方につけ、AI時代の先駆者へ
ここまで、学生がClaude Codeを最大限に活用し、自律型AIを「最強の味方」にするための全手法を見てきました。
最も重要なポイントは、AIに答えを丸投げするのではなく、ラーニングモードを通じた対話によって自身の設計能力や問題解決スキルを磨き続けることです。
コストの壁も、Student Builder Programやプロンプトキャッシングを駆使すれば、学生の皆さんの手が届く範囲で十分に運用可能です。
AIを自在に使いこなす経験は、将来のキャリアにおいて他の追随を許さない圧倒的な武器になるはずです。
まずは、Claude Proを今すぐ導入し、次世代のエンジニアリング体験を始めましょう。もし研究や開発プロジェクトがあるなら、Student Builder Programへの申請も忘れずに行ってください。
さらに体系的にAIスキルを習得し、就職活動での強みにしたい方には、Aidemyでの学習や、キャリア支援が充実しているAI CONNECTの活用も非常におすすめです。
自律型AIと共に、あなたの創造性を解き放つ新しい一歩を、今ここから踏み出しましょう。


